Korean-Russian Carrots

Cultural Context

Korean-Russian Carrots, also known as Korean Carrot Salad, reflect the culinary fusion between Korean and Russian cuisines, particularly popular in post-Soviet states. This colorful dish is often served at gatherings and celebrations, showcasing the vibrant flavors of garlic, spices, and tangy dressing. Its popularity has spread globally, with variations appearing in many international potlucks and picnics, making it a beloved side dish.

Servings4
4 cups carrots
3 cloves garlic
1 medium onion
1/2 cup vegetable oil
1/4 cup vinegar
2 tablespoons sugar
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1 teaspoon coriander
1 teaspoon red chili flakes
1/4 cup green onions
2 tablespoons sesame oil

1

Shred the carrots using a grater or food processor.

2

Finely chop the garlic and onion.

3

Heat vegetable oil in a pan over medium heat until shimmering.

4

Add the garlic and onion to the pan; sauté until fragrant, about 2-3 minutes.

5

In a large bowl, combine the shredded carrots, sautéed garlic and onion, and vinegar.

6

Sprinkle in sugar, salt, black pepper, coriander, and red chili flakes; mix well.

7

Drizzle with sesame oil and toss to combine thoroughly.

8

Let the mixture sit for at least 30 minutes to allow flavors to meld.

9

Garnish with chopped green onions before serving.
